20/02/2010 - Withycombe 20 Minehead Barbarians 20
Withycombe got off to the perfect start and were 5-0 up within the first
5 minutes, having kicked off down the slope they won a turnover and
mounted a sustained attack before a chipping through for the left
winger to score wide out and take a 5 –0 lead.
Withycombe continued to dominate the early exchanges opting for high
balls down the right where they found Dominic Westcott in fine form ,
not missing a ball and getting in some excellent clearances . The
Barbarians were again fielding a much changed side due to Chris
Thorne’s wedding with no fewer than 7 colts in the side and
understandably took a while to settle but having opted play an open
game they were soon exerting pressure of their own, with Jack White
almost going over on an individual run
Minehead got back on terms when Max Mallinson got a dream debut
try , having charged down a kick out of defence to gather and sprint in
from the 22. and level the scores at halftime.
The second half turned out to be a thriller it looked for while as if
Minehead were going to take control of the game . Scrum half and man
of the match Jack Claydon set up the next score with a break from his
own 5 metre line showing his class in evading tackle after tackle
carrying the ball to the Withycombe 22 before giving a long pass back
inside to Scott Langdon who put Dom Westcott in near the posts . Mike
Hutchinson added the points and soon after kicked a penalty to
increase the lead to 15 – 5 . but it was Withycombe who then went on
the rampage scoring three tries to lead 20 –15 ,. Two of which came
from fine individual runs by each of their wingers from deep positions
to add to a close range forward effort.
Minehead came right back and a slick midfield handling movement
following a break by Mike Hutchinson saw Dom Wescott go over for his
second try . Hutchinson’s kick drifted tantalisingly past the right hand
post to leave the final scores level at 20-20
It was good to see Joe White come on for his first senior appearance
for 4 years having finally recovered from what once looked like a career
ending broken ankle .
